I felt the Earth beneath me as it was, made out of yellow bricks and neverending randomly placed patches of flowers. My hair was a mess and so was my dress, being ripped at the hem with subtle hints of dirt on the back. I stood up and I finally had a moment to look, to look at all the beauty this place held. From a room so dim and dull, to a place so bright and vibrant. And then it came to me, I too, like Dorothy, am somewhere over the rainbow.

High pitched giggles from one of the flower patches interupted my concentration, could there be people with me? My eyes widened as I saw one of the women stand, and then another and another. So radiant they were, they had the stance of ballerinas but the height of a child.

'Welcome to Munchkinland,' they said in unison, sounding like a song.
